Job description

Lead Due Diligence Engineer (Water)

Ramboll is seeking motivated candidates to join our Water & Wastewater Treatment Division in Arlington, VA; Richmond, VA; Syracuse, NY; Brentwood, TN or Baton Rouge, LA. Other office locations may be considered on a case-by-case basis. This is a hybrid position.

The Lead Water Due Diligence Engineer will support water and wastewater due diligence and master planning projects. The role spans service areas including water supply, water infrastructure, and water and wastewater treatment to develop comprehensive water solutions for mission-critical facilities. The successful candidate will collaborate across teams, evaluate and interpret data, and exercise independent judgment when selecting and applying applicable regulations and standards. The position also involves leading tasks and clearly presenting technical information to external clients.

Travel may be required depending on project requ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Conduct water and wastewater due diligence assessments and master plans, including desktop reviews, site visits to industrial facilities, coordination with utilities and/or regulatory agencies, review of historical site information, and preparation of client-specific reports.
  • Analyze, develop, and interpret reports, drawings, analytical results, and other data required for planning and design projects related to water management, both quantity and quality.
  • Prepare and present technical deliverables (e.g., design calculations, field data results and conclusions, and/or cost estimates) to audiences that may include project team members, the project manager, the project owner, and external clients.
  • Support the development and mentoring of junior team members.
  • Prepare proposals, fee estimates, purchase orders, and subcontract agreements.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ering, Environmental Engineering, or a related science discipline (e.g., environmental science, geology, chemistry, physics, or biology).
  • 4+ years of relevant experience in civil engineering and/or water due diligence.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license, or the ability to obtain licensure within the primary state of residence/operation, as relevant to the role.
  • Comfortable working in a fast-paced, transactional environment and managing multiple tasks simultaneously.
  • Experience working for industrial and/or mission critical clients is a plus.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Ability to work effectively on teams with diverse skill sets, including engineers from other disciplines, scientists, and subcontracted professionals.
  • Commitment to delivering high-quality work products and supporting Ramboll's growth.
